Why did the apostle John call himself, "the disciple whom Jesus loved"?

John refers to himself, on at least four occasions, as "the disciple whom Jesus loved"? (John 13:23 , 19:26 , 21:7 & 21:20 ). Why is this? It seems a bit arrogant, especially as Jesus loved the other disciples as well.
